Should You Buy a 2001 Volvo C70?

The 2001 Volvo C70 is a stylish coupe that combines performance with luxury, making it an appealing choice for those who appreciate European design and engineering. With a robust 2.3L I5 engine producing 236 horsepower and 244 lb-ft of torque, this front-wheel-drive vehicle offers a spirited driving experience. The 5-speed manual transmission enhances driver engagement, while the vehicle's fuel economy of 21 MPG combined is reasonable for a sporty coupe. Priced at an MSRP of $34,550, the C70 positions itself as a premium option in the used car market.

In terms of safety and reliability, the C70 boasts an impressive reliability score of 99.8/100, with no reported crash or fire incidents. The NHTSA complaint data indicates some concerns primarily related to tires and vehicle speed control, but overall, the vehicle has a strong safety profile. This makes the C70 a solid choice for buyers seeking a reliable and enjoyable driving experience without compromising on safety.
